Seattle hosts six FIFA World Cup 2026 matches at Lumen Field between June 15 and July 6. For supporter clubs, destination-travel operators, and regional fan chapters, a private charter is usually the most practical way to move a group from hotel (or meeting point) to the stadium and back. This page covers what vehicle fits which group, the booking timeline to work to, and how match-day pickup actually runs at Lumen Field. Who this is for

Country-specific supporter clubs (American Outlaws chapters, Egyptian fan networks, Iranian diaspora groups, Mexican fan coalitions, Qatari and Bosnian supporter groups), destination travel package organizers, and regional fan chapters coming in from Portland, Vancouver, or the Bay Area. Two of the six Seattle matches feature Egypt (Jun 15 vs Belgium, Jun 26 vs Iran), which concentrates demand from Egyptian-American networks across a two-week window — if that's your group, the operator supply constraint is real. USA vs Australia on June 19 is the single highest-demand Seattle fixture and pulls American Outlaws chapters from across the Pacific Northwest.

Picking the right vehicle

Three vehicle sizes cover most fan-group needs:

  • 14-passenger shuttle or Sprinter van. Right for small chapters (10–14 people), VIP subsets, or a post-match dinner group peeling off from the main coach. Cheaper than a minibus and more flexible in traffic.
  • 24–35-passenger minibus. The middle tier. Works for supporter chapters of 20–30 or splitting a larger group between two vehicles when you want more nimble pickup locations than a full motorcoach allows.
  • 56-passenger motorcoach. The workhorse. For full supporter trips of 30+, this is almost always the best per-head economics — luggage bays, comfortable seating, a proper PA for the driver. The 56-passenger coach is the most commonly dispatched vehicle for World Cup fan bookings in Seattle.

If your group is over 56, we'll configure two coaches running parallel routes to the stadium so the whole group lands at the gates within minutes of each other.

Booking timeline

  • 30 days out. Lock vehicle size and confirm the match-day itinerary — pickup address, departure time, Lumen Field drop-off, planned return. This is the window where you still have real vehicle choice.
  • 14 days out. Confirm final passenger count, any special requirements (accessibility, luggage, decoration plans), and dispatch notes. Availability tightens noticeably inside this window, especially for USA vs Australia.
  • 7 days out. Driver assigned, pickup coordinates and post-match staging location confirmed. Changes past this point are possible but narrower.
  • 1 day out. Driver confirmation call the day before the match; any last-minute tweaks locked.

For USA vs Australia (Jun 19) and the two Egypt matches (Jun 15, Jun 26), operators are already taking holds — booking inside 14 days is possible but your vehicle choice narrows and pricing sits at the top of the range.

What's included

A fan-group charter day rate covers the driver, fuel, match-day routing, idle time between drop-off and pickup, and post-match coordination at the agreed staging point. A typical 10-hour day rate for a 56-passenger coach starts around $2,500–3,000 — built from a 3-hour minimum at $1,500–$1,800 plus $200 each additional hour — with match-day pricing running 15–20% above a standard day. Add fuel surcharge, gratuity, and parking on top. Extras that shift pricing: pickups outside the central corridor, multi-stop pre-match routing (hotel → pre-match pub → stadium), tight evening turnarounds, or premium vehicles.

Fan group specifics

Flags, scarves, chants, and singing inside the bus are welcome — drivers on this circuit have worked Sounders matches for years. Drivers familiar with Lumen Field drop-off zones know the Occidental Ave S patterns, which gates are active for a given configuration, and where the post-match staging lots are. Post-match exit matters more than the pre-match drop: the stadium footprint is closed to motorcoach idling during play, so the driver stages off-site and returns to a pre-agreed pickup point (usually one block off Occidental, clear of the main fan exit flow) at a set time after full-time, with a built-in buffer for extra time and penalties.
